Both Levante and Athletic are entering this match with recent setbacks: Levante after a respectable defeat against Barcelona, and Athletic following a draw at home against Elche that tempered their winning momentum.

Levante's Current Form

Ahead of their regional derby against Villarreal, Luís Castro anticipates fielding a more familiar lineup than the one seen against Barcelona. Iván Romero and Bardeli are expected to return to the starting eleven, with Tape potentially making his debut for Levante. While the coach offered no specifics on player fitness, he expressed confidence in his squad's ability to meet Athletic's challenge. Hugo Sotelo is sidelined for Levante, out with a knee sprain and not expected back until after the FIFA international break.

Similar to their opponents, Athletic faces a derby against Alavés this Saturday at San Mamés. However, their immediate focus remains on the present match. There is anticipation regarding how Terzic will configure the attack, especially with Guruzeta potentially available. A successful outing from Orriols would cap off an encouraging week. Conversely, a poor result would force the coach back to the drawing board. Athletic has secured points in their last five away matches against Levante, winning three of those encounters.

Key Matchup

Romero vs. Berenguer. Levante's forward scored against Barcelona and was instrumental in Luís Castro's team believing they could equalize late in the game. Athletic fans saw a similar impact from Berenguer's introduction, who played a crucial role in their recent draw.
